If you like free and can work with PDF or TIFF, this resource might work for you.
Forest Service map clearinghouse Find your state, then subregion and download whichever quads you need. Marking them up requires software, but you can simply crop and print the base maps you need without anything fancy.

If you have Windows, there are a number of offerings, some of which come with the purchase of a GPS and then there's National Geographic...
If you have a Mac, there's Mac GPS Pro, which I am now using. I got all the USGS and Forest Service topos for my state as well. It takes getting used to as it's not so point and click as others but it's pretty snazzy and quite powerful. And of course, since you can also run Windows on a Mac, you can also get any of the Windows packages and run them that way.

I often use
www.caltopo.com , which has both USGS and Forest Service maps. You can draw a path and then measure distance and elevation change.

We use Acme Mapper---and find them much more accurate than NatGeo.
And they are free, and easy to use. acmemapper.com

The only problem with acmemapper is, no connecting the GPS and uploading tracks. No making a route and transferring to GPS.

I use Garmin's free "Basecamp" software and free topo maps from
http://www.gpsfiledepot.com. Works on both WinPCs and Macs.
